Jan > On Thu, Apr 3, 2014 at 11:47 AM, Jan Grulich <jgrul...@redhat.com> wrote: > > Hi, > > > > I would like to make libmm-qt and libnm-qt as KDE frameworks, they are > > based > > only on Qt, so they could be in Tier 1. I've already started (you can see > > framework branches) and I would like to ask to a few questions. > > > > 1) How to name them? Until now we named them ModemManagerQt and > > NetworkManagerQt, but if we add KF5 prefix, it would be maybe better to > > name it > > only ModemManager/NetworkManager (with KF5 prefix), but there is a > > problem, if > > you will use it in the source code. Imagine including > > <NetworkManager/WirelessDevice>, it will work, but it kinda conflicts with > > NetworkManager headers and it's not clear which one is used, whether > > KF5::NetworkManager or NetworkManager. > > > > 2) When to release them? We are not probably ready to be released with the > > first wave of KDE frameworks and it's probably too late.
